Bridal make-up for perfect wedding pictures

The pictures of your wedding will last forever and are usually the most seen from the family album. Professional photographers and make-up artists and hair stylists know perfectly hot to make outstand your most suitable features in front of the camera.

Here we give you some make-up and hair tips you should take into account for the photo shoot.

Make-up base: Always remember that the base must be applied on your neck. It must be form a color similar to the tone of your neck’s skin. Choose yellowish tones; forget about the pinks and browns. If you have a perfect skin you don’t need to worry about this.

Always choose matte products: you have to try shades barely darker than your skin’s color, so it looks natural on the pictures.

Forget of the glows around the eyes and on the cheeks: Any skin imperfection or expression wrinkles will be remarked by the flash.

Dull lips: Avoid using gloss, but apply a hydrant before painting them if you have dry lips.
Avoid places with too much sunlight or direct light: Places with shadows or sifted lights are ideal.

Black and white: If you go for black and white pictures, get them after the pictures in color, since the make-up with the first ones is totally different and more remarked, pastel colors look very well in a color picture, but practically fade in a clack and white picture. Try to remark your make-up with brown tones and red for the lips.

Watch the eyebrows: Most times, in short shots they look messy and artificial, use shadows and a fine brush to retouch them. Never use pencils.

Simple does: Never apply to many products on your hair; they make it look too rigid. If you like to wear it tied up, nothing like a chignon.

Relax…To look perfect on pics. Having a massage the day before is a good idea.

Natural bridal bouquet: if your bouquet is made from natural flowers, you should have two of them: one for the photo shoot and another one for the ceremony.

Sleep well: Taking a good rest the bight before is fundamental for beauty and especially for pictures.
